Immigrants from Grenada vs Immigrants from Senegal Female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 67,188,736 people shows a slight posit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Grenada and poverty level among females in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.076 and weighted average of 16.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 90,102,855 people shows a mild negative corre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Senegal and poverty level among females in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.374 and weighted average of 16.5%, a difference of 2.2%.
